Transaction 281d66564beff86031f378cd8569bc109a6074eb75cfa8ebb794d27dc8fc1547
3 Input
2 Outputs
- 281d66564beff86031f378cd8569bc109a6074eb75cfa8ebb794d27dc8fc1547:0
- 281d66564beff86031f378cd8569bc109a6074eb75cfa8ebb794d27dc8fc1547:1
value 5008701
address 1PSVSeWhnHF2DUyDVnh6XVGMJViH3kGg5D
value 50000000
address 14rHMSckHMk8vkyNC7FRRi7UZjYB2R8LRr